What is irs form 8937 report

The IRS Form 8937 Report is a tax form used by issuers to report organizational actions affecting the basis of securities, such as liquidation events.

Understanding the IRS Form 8937 Report

The IRS Form 8937 is designed to report organizational actions that affect the basis of securities. It serves vital purposes for both issuers and taxpayers by documenting significant financial events such as liquidations. Understanding the definition and purpose of the IRS Form 8937 ensures compliance and accurate tax reporting.
  • This form is essential for issuers to communicate tax basis changes accurately.
  • Timely filing aids in avoiding penalties and supports compliance with IRS regulations.
  • Common scenarios requiring this form include liquidations and reorganizations.
